If you're someone who likes owning a physical copy of a game, Sony has some bad news. Sony has announced that starting January 2028, it will stop producing physical PlayStation discs for all new games releasing on PS5 consoles. After January 2028, new releases will only be available to buy digitally, either through the PlayStation Store or from retailers in digital format. Games that are already out or launch before January 2028 won’t be affected and will still be available on disc.

Sony says the decision to go all digital for all new PS games in fact stems from what people have been wanting. “This is a natural direction for Sony Interactive Entertainment to adapt to consumer trends as the general preference for digital media significantly outpaces physical discs,” the company said justifying the move. In other words, more people have been buying games digitally lately, per Sony, and the company is simply following the trend.

Interestingly, the news – which is huge and the end of an era for games on discs – comes even as Rockstar Games announced that all GTA 6 (Grand Theft Auto 6) pre-orders will ship in digital format, even to those who order a physical disc. Clearly, Rockstar knew a thing or two about Sony’s plans even if the decision has been drawing criticism online from purists and multiple retailers who are not too pleased with it.

Why physical games still matter to many players

Digital media has several advantages but there are also few disadvantages. Physical copies of games can be resold once you're done with them. You can lend them over to someone or simply keep on a shelf as something tangible. It is something that you actually own. Digital copies can’t offer that. You don't truly "own" a digital game the same way you own a disc. If a console's servers shut down or your account gets locked, access to your library could be at risk.
